! 26: #include <machine/cpu.h>
! 27:
! 28: /*
! 29: * Machine dependent constants for PA-RISC.
! 30: */
! 31:
! 32: #define _MACHINE hppa64
! 33: #define MACHINE "hppa64"
! 34: #define _MACHINE_ARCH hppa64
! 35: #define MACHINE_ARCH "hppa64"
! 36: #define MID_MACHINE MID_HPPA20
! 37:
! 38: /*
! 39: * Round p (pointer or byte index) up to a correctly-aligned value for all
! 40: * data types (int, long, ...). The result is u_int and must be cast to
! 41: * any desired pointer type.
! 42: */
! 43: #define ALIGNBYTES 7
! 44: #define ALIGN(p) (((u_long)(p) + ALIGNBYTES) &~ ALIGNBYTES)
! 45: #define ALIGNED_POINTER(p,t) ((((u_long)(p)) & (sizeof(t) - 1)) == 0)
! 46:
! 47: #define PAGE_SIZE 4096
! 48: #define PAGE_MASK (PAGE_SIZE-1)
! 49: #define PAGE_SHIFT 12
! 50:
! 51: #define NBPG 4096 /* bytes/page */
! 52: #define PGOFSET (NBPG-1) /* byte offset into page */
! 53: #define PGSHIFT 12 /* LOG2(NBPG) */
! 54:
! 55: #define KERNBASE 0x00000000 /* start of kernel virtual */
! 56:
! 57: #define DEV_BSHIFT 9 /* log2(DEV_BSIZE) */
! 58: #define DEV_BSIZE (1 << DEV_BSHIFT)
! 59: #define BLKDEV_IOSIZE 2048
! 60: #define MAXPHYS (64 * 1024) /* max raw I/O transfer size */
! 61:
! 62: #define MACHINE_STACK_GROWS_UP 1 /* stack grows to higher addresses */
! 63:
! 64: #define USPACE (4 * NBPG) /* pages for user struct and kstack */
! 65: #define USPACE_ALIGN (0) /* u-area alignment 0-none */
! 66:
! 67: #ifndef MSGBUFSIZE
! 68: #define MSGBUFSIZE 2*NBPG /* default message buffer size */
! 69: #endif
! 70:
! 71: /*
! 72: * Constants related to network buffer management.
! 73: */
! 74: #define NMBCLUSTERS 4096 /* map size, max cluster allocation */
! 75:
! 76: /*
! 77: * Minimum and maximum sizes of the kernel malloc arena in PAGE_SIZE-sized
! 78: * logical pages.
! 79: */
! 80: #define NKMEMPAGES_MIN_DEFAULT ((8 * 1024 * 1024) >> PAGE_SHIFT)
! 81: #define NKMEMPAGES_MAX_DEFAULT ((128 * 1024 * 1024) >> PAGE_SHIFT)
! 82:
! 83: /* pages ("clicks") (4096 bytes) to disk blocks */
! 84: #define ctod(x) ((x) << (PAGE_SHIFT - DEV_BSHIFT))
! 85: #define dtoc(x) ((x) >> (PAGE_SHIFT - DEV_BSHIFT))
! 86:
! 87: /* pages to bytes */
! 88: #define ctob(x) ((x) << PAGE_SHIFT)
! 89: #define btoc(x) (((x) + PAGE_MASK) >> PAGE_SHIFT)
! 90:
! 91: #define btodb(x) ((x) >> DEV_BSHIFT)
! 92: #define dbtob(x) ((x) << DEV_BSHIFT)
! 93:
! 94: #ifndef _LOCORE
! 95: #define CONADDR conaddr
! 96: #define CONUNIT conunit
! 97: #define COM_FREQ 7372800
! 98: extern hppa_hpa_t conaddr;
! 99: extern int conunit;
! 100: #endif
! 101:
